Experimental solubility of diosgenin and estriol in various solvents between T = (293.2–328.2) K

Highlights: • Solubility data measured for diosgenin and estriol in approximately 12 solvents. • Measurements in the temperature range, T = (293.2–328.2) K. • Isothermal method used with determination by combined DTA/TGA. • Data correlated using the T-K-Wilson and NRTL models. - Abstract: Solubility measurements at equilibrium were performed for the systems (3β,25R)-spirost-5-en-3-ol (diosgenin) and (16α,17β)-estra-1,3,5(10)-triene-3,16,17-triol (estriol) in at least 12 solvents at atmospheric pressure within the temperature range T = (293.2–328.2 K) using combined digital thermal analysis and thermal gravimetric analysis (DTA/TGA) to determine compositions at saturation. The results were modelled with the NRTL and Tsuboka-Katayma modified Wilson activity coefficient models. The models employed provided a satisfactory correlation of the experimental data. Furthermore melting points and enthalpies of melting of diosgenin and estriol were determined by combined DTA/TGA.
